The Radiologist/Medical Imaging techniques are certified technologists who capture images of organs, bone, and tissue for patient diagnosis. Technologists are equipped with the technological skills to handle imaging equipment and the interpersonal skills necessary for patient care. Educational and license requirements vary by state and profession, 4 year degree programme is common for radiologist/medical imaging technologists.
A technologist produces radiography of patients with the help of X-ray to find the exact medical condition of the patient. In addition with X-ray, a radiographer also considers X-rays, CT scans, MRI for producing radiography. Radiology field is broadly divided into two areas namely diagnostic radiology and interventional radiology.
